Accessing Madera County Newspaper Archives
Alright, let's talk about finding those newspaper archives! Newspapers are invaluable sources of information for historical research. They offer a window into the past, providing details about events, people, and everyday life in Madera County. Obituary information can confirm dates, locations, relationships, and accomplishments of deceased individuals. Fortunately, there are several avenues you can explore to access these archives. Here are some effective strategies:
- Madera County Library: The Madera County Library is an excellent starting point. Many libraries maintain archives of local newspapers, either in physical format (microfilm or bound volumes) or digital format. Check their website or contact the library directly to inquire about their newspaper holdings and access policies. Librarians can provide assistance in navigating the archives and using the available resources.
- Online Newspaper Archives: Several online platforms offer digitized newspaper collections. Websites like Newspapers.com, GenealogyBank.com, and Chronicling America (Library of Congress) may contain Madera County newspapers. These platforms often require a subscription, but they can provide convenient access to a vast collection of historical newspapers from the comfort of your home. Use keywords like "Madera," "Madera County," and the specific name of the newspaper you're interested in to narrow your search. Try searching for Ioscis Madera CASC to find the news related to them.
- Madera County Historical Society: The Madera County Historical Society is dedicated to preserving and sharing the history of the region. They may have a collection of local newspapers, clippings, and other historical documents that could be relevant to your research. Contact the historical society to learn about their resources and access procedures.
- University Libraries: University libraries in California, such as Fresno State or UC Merced, may have collections of regional newspapers. Check their online catalogs or contact the special collections department to inquire about their holdings.

Finding Obituary Information in Madera County
Now, let's focus on finding those obituaries. Obituaries provide valuable biographical information about deceased individuals, including their date and place of birth, family members, accomplishments, and funeral arrangements. They can be an important source for genealogical research and for understanding the lives of people connected to Ioscis Madera CASC. Here are several ways to find obituary information in Madera County:
- Newspaper Archives: As mentioned earlier, newspaper archives are a primary source for obituaries. Search the online and offline newspaper archives for Madera County, focusing on the period when the person of interest died. Most newspapers published obituaries, either as news articles or paid notices.
- Funeral Homes: Contact funeral homes in Madera County. Funeral homes often maintain records of the services they have conducted, including copies of obituaries. They may be able to provide you with information about obituaries for individuals connected to Ioscis Madera CASC. Check the websites of local funeral homes for online obituary listings.
- Online Genealogy Websites: Websites like Ancestry.com, FindAGrave.com, and Legacy.com have extensive collections of obituaries and burial records. Search these websites using the name of the person you're looking for and keywords like "Madera" or "Madera County." These platforms often allow users to contribute information, so you may find additional details or photos related to the deceased.
- Social Security Death Index (SSDI): The SSDI is a database of death records maintained by the Social Security Administration. While it doesn't provide full obituaries, it can confirm the death date and place of residence for individuals. This information can be helpful in narrowing your search for an obituary in newspaper archives or other sources.
- Family Records: Don't forget to check with family members or friends who may have copies of obituaries or memorial programs. Personal collections can be a valuable source of information that may not be available elsewhere.
When searching for obituaries, be aware that the availability and format of obituaries may vary depending on the time period and the newspaper. Older obituaries may be shorter and less detailed than more recent ones.
Utilizing Online Search Strategies
Okay, let's get strategic with online searches! To effectively find newspaper articles and obituaries related to Ioscis Madera CASC, you need to use the right search terms and techniques. Effective online searching is a key skill for historical research. Here are some tips to help you refine your search strategy:
- Keywords: Use a combination of keywords related to Ioscis Madera CASC, the person's name, and relevant events or topics. For example, try searching for "Ioscis Madera CASC scholarship," "John Smith Madera obituary," or "Madera County school board meeting." Be specific and experiment with different combinations of keywords.
- Boolean Operators: Use Boolean operators like "AND," "OR," and "NOT" to refine your search. For example, "Ioscis Madera CASC AND scholarship" will find results that contain both terms, while "Madera County newspaper NOT Fresno" will exclude results related to Fresno newspapers.
- Phrase Searching: Enclose phrases in quotation marks to search for exact matches. For example, "Ioscis Madera CASC" will only find results that contain that exact phrase.
- Wildcard Characters: Use wildcard characters like "" to search for variations of a word. For example, "educat Madera" will find results that contain words like "education," "educator," or "educational" in relation to Madera.
- Date Ranges: If you know the approximate date range you're interested in, use the search tool's date filter to narrow your results. This can be particularly helpful when searching for obituaries.
- Advanced Search: Take advantage of advanced search features offered by search engines and online archives. These features often allow you to specify criteria like publication title, author, and document type.
Remember to evaluate the credibility of your sources. Look for information from reputable news organizations, historical societies, and libraries. Be wary of information from unreliable websites or blogs.
